Dr. Aaron Ashabraner, MD is a family medicine physician in Noblesville, IN and has over 20 years of experience in the medical field. He graduated from Indiana University School of Medicine in 2002. He is affiliated with Indiana University Health North Hospital. He is accepting new patients and telehealth appointments.
